Dog Stands Guard For Toddler Found He Abandoned In The Woods

| Published on November 5, 2015

In Jacksboro, Minnesota, a toddler was found abandoned in a hog pen in a heavily wooded area. But the toddler wasn’t alone, he had a guardian angel watching over him. His guardian angel was a female Pit Bull named Dixie.

The employees of Waggin’ Tails Pet Resort heard a child crying in the woods outside their building at around 8:30 am. Curious where the cries are coming from, the employees followed the crying sound which led them to the location of the toddler abandoned in an overgrown hog pen. However, the toddler wasn’t alone; they also found a Pit Bull inside the pen, who appears to be protecting the child.

The Pit Bull followed the employees as they carried the child away. It turns out, the mother of the child was high on meth when she took her child to the woods and left him there. The child’s mother was charged with aggravated child abuse and neglect. The child is now in the custody of the Department of Children’s Services.

On the other hand, the Pit Bull named Dixie, belonged to a neighbor who was out of town. However, Dixie is now missing and her owner has been looking for her everywhere.

According to Dixie’s owner, Charles Pittman, Dixie looks like a Brindle Pit but she’s more of a light brown with white on her. Unfortunately, Mr. Pittman has no photo of Dixie. But the Pit Bull pictured above, which is owned by someone at Waggin’ Tails, looks very similar to Dixie.
